The Pains Of Being Pure At Heart played the Chorlton Irish Centre on Saturday 22nd May 2009. A brutually hot gig and one that Manchester will remember for a long time.
________________________________________
In an interview with Nothing Bad magazine ( http://nothingbadmag.com/index.php/music/pains-of-being-pure-at-heart/ ) Peggy Wang from POBPAH declares this concert as her most memorable gig:
Q: You have toured all over the world with your band (The Pains Of Being Pure At Heart), where has your most memorable gig been?
A: I would have to say the Manchester gig at the Chorlton Irish Center. If I've ever been "high on life" it would have been at that show. It was a bunch of sweaty kids moshing to "Teenager in Love" and it just felt so surreal, like I was in a parallel universe, where people think wussy songs about love are actually kind of punk. Afterwards, we sold our merch out the back of our van in a big parking lot, and all these kids were hanging around. I just felt really happy to be contributing to such a quintessential teen moment, when your curfew's been half an hour extended and you're just enjoying the finer things in life, like sitting on the hood of a car and pretending to be bored.
